Xbox 360 by Ken Charnly
At the October 4th 2005 X 05 events in
Amsterdam, the gaming industry felt that
Microsoft would use this event to announce
the Xbox 360 games lineup for its release in
North America and Europe. The problem with
that is it didn’t happen. In its place is
more confusion on the Xbox 360 games that
will be available.
Peter Moore the corporate vice president of
Xbox marketing and publishing bragged that
there were 200 Xbox 360 games in
development. At the same time Chief Xbox
officer Robbie Bach just promised they would
have the best games and launch lineup of any
console yet. But neither would list all the
games that will go on sale November 22 at
the launch of the Xbox 360 in the United
States.
Now to add to the confusion is a Microsoft
press release titled “Xbox 360 launch
line-up announced”. It has only three first
party games listed under a heading a heading
of “Titles that will form part of an
impressive Christmas holiday portfolio.
Project Gotham Racing 3, Perfect Dark Zero
and Kameio Elements of Power. Then they have
a second categlry of games called “Other
great games announced or shown at X05 that
included FIFA 06, Saint’s Row, Too Human,
Crackdown just to name a few.
The finally the release listed a third
category, “Franchise titles that will make
their debut on Xbox 360” this included
Superman Returns: The Videogame, Call of
Duty 2, Tom Clancy’s Splinter Cell 4 and
more. Now the fact that about half of these
have 2006 release dates and some were just
announced it would be impossible for the
game to be contained in the Xbox 360 launch
lineup as the title indicates.
A effort to clear up the confusion David
Reid, director of platform marketing for the
Xbox 360 was asked exactly what games would
be available at the launch. He stated there
would be 15-20 Xbox 360 titles available on
launch day and another half–dozen by the end
of the year. So more double speak? He would
only confirm eight being available on
November 22. They are Project Gotham Racing
3, Kameo, Perfect Dark Zero, Madden NFL 06,
NBA Live 06, Tiger Woods PGA Tour 06, Need
for Speed Most Wanted, and FIFA 06: Road to
FIFA World Cup.
As for the other seven to twelve Xbox 360
games that were to be available, Reid stated
they would be announced in the next few
weeks. According to him “They are currently
in the final stages of certification” this
is referring to the quality assurance
process all third party games must go
through from each console maker. With that
said it would be likely if any of the
submitted games that were not mentioned did
not pass this process it will not be
available at the time of Xbox 360 release on
November 22 in North America.
The decision to rush games is a two headed
sword. On one hand, release dates are made
for a reason: to take advantage of a holiday
sales season. On the other hand, thanks to
word of mouth and game sites the gamer of
today can tell if a game was rushed and a
games reputation can be destroyed faster
than it was built. In the Xbox 360’s case
there has been an extreme amount of pre
release publicity and hype, which will make
or break the success of the console and
games themselves.
Three of the games that were verified to be
available on release date are Microsoft
titles and they would have an advantage. But
none of the twelve titles are make or break
titles for the Xbox 360 so the console
should be spared, and hopefully PS3 will
have the same launch questions.
As with any Microsoft release the Xbox 360
is shrouded in rumor, speculation, and
expectation. Microsoft fuels this by being
very closed mouth with any specific
information. It looks like right now we can
just sit and wait.
